Bill Raftery leaves ESPN for Fox Sports One

Bill Raftery, the legendary college basketball announcer who has been calling games on ESPN – primarily, Big Monday – for years, is leaving for Fox Sports 1. The move was announced via press release moments ago. Raftery will still call NCAA tournament games for CBS – something he’s done for over 20 years now – but he will now be calling Big East games on Fox Sports 1 with Gus Johnson.

True. But Fox Sports does have a pretty good foothold in sports programming.

MLB: Saturday games, All-star game, playoffs

NFL: Regional Sunday's and I'm sure they'll attempt to land a contract for a national weekly game. Rumor has it the NFL is looking to sell rights to half of the Thursday night games. Bidding war with NBC?

College football: They've got tie ins with the big 12, big 10 and PAC 12...plus big 10 and PAC championships games. I think CUSA is also affiliated with Fox Sports. It may not be SEC but they do have TV tie ins with major conferences.

Soccer: Not my cup of tea but they're somewhat exclusive when it comes to soccer programming.
